innerwidth(innerwidth包含滚动条吗)
innerwidth(innerwidth包含滚动条吗)详细介绍
本文目录一览:JavaScript的window.innerWidth和screen.availWidth有什么区别?_百度...
1、inner:内部。指的是内部部分,不含滚动条。avail:可用的。可用区域,不含滚动条,易与inner混淆。window.innerWidth/innerHeight:浏览器可见区域的内宽度、高度(不含浏览器的边框,但包含滚动条)。
2、window.screen.width 功能:声明了显示浏览器的屏幕的宽度,以像素计。window.screen.availWidth 功能:声明了显示浏览器的屏幕的可用宽度,以像素计。例如:获取浏览器的宽度、高度、可用宽度、可用高度。
3、window.screen.width指的是你手机或电脑屏幕的高度,无论你怎么改变浏览器高度他都是不变的,和你的屏幕分辨率相关。 两者的高度是不一样的,使用js中的alert()方法打印这两个高度就会发现它们之间的差别。
4、这里是检查窗的宽度。窗的宽度可能等于0的。例如通过赋值,建一个窗,或用鼠标拉一个窗,值写错了,或忘了拉动鼠标,可能 小于等于 0。如果 窗的内宽小于或等于 0,则 宽度定为 屏幕宽度。
5、window.screen.width是只读属性,不能修改的。
innerwidth为什么会加上内边距
1、width() 是元素内部实际内容的宽度(不包含内边距和边框的宽度);innerWidth() 则是上面的width()再加上内边距;outerWidth() 则是上面的innerWidth()再加上边框的宽度。
2、是因为一个css设置:box-sizing 默认是content-box,实际width=设置width+边框+间距,而在border-box下,宽度设置好,边框和间距会自动调整宽度,满足设置的值。
3、Window 对象的属性 innerheight 返回窗口的文档显示区的高度。innerwidth 返回窗口的文档显示区的宽度。
innerwidth什么意思
innerwidth 返回窗口的文档显示区的宽度。
width:取得第一个匹配元素当前计算的宽度值。innerWidth:获取第一个匹配元素内部区域宽度(包括内边距、不包括边框)。outerWidth:获取第一个匹配元素外部宽度(默认包括内边距和边框)。
innerWidth 是窗口的空间,它包括一些系统提供的像标题和滚动条之类的区域,有些区域是用户无法干预的,比如这个图片中的右侧滚动条,你是没法使用这个空间的。
inner:内部。指的是内部部分,不含滚动条。avail:可用的。可用区域,不含滚动条,易与inner混淆。window.innerWidth/innerHeight:浏览器可见区域的内宽度、高度(不含浏览器的边框,但包含滚动条)。
window.innerWidth=浏览器窗口的内部宽度 例子 textarea 元素内无内容或者内容不超过可视区,滚动不出现或不可用的情况下。scrollWidth=clientWidth,两者皆为内容可视区的宽度。offsetWidth为元素的实际宽度。
outerWidth属性设置或返回窗口的外部宽度,包括所有的界面元素(如工具栏/滚动)。innerheight 返回窗口的文档显示区的高度。innerwidth 返回窗口的文档显示区的宽度。
jquery中innerwidth,outerwidth和width的区别是什么?
1、在jQuery中width、innerWidth、以及outerWidth的区别如下:width:取得第一个匹配元素当前计算的宽度值。innerWidth:获取第一个匹配元素内部区域宽度(包括内边距、不包括边框)。
2、clientWidth是内容可视区的宽度。offsetWidth是元素的实际宽度。offsetWidth和width区别 offsetWidth属性可以返回对象的padding+border+元素width属性值之和,style.width返回值就是定义的width属性值。
3、window.screen.width指的是你手机或电脑屏幕的高度,无论你怎么改变浏览器高度他都是不变的,和你的屏幕分辨率相关。 两者的高度是不一样的,使用js中的alert()方法打印这两个高度就会发现它们之间的差别。
4、window.innerWidth/innerHeight:浏览器可见区域的内宽度、高度(不含浏览器的边框,但包含滚动条)。兼容:ie9/chrome、firefox。
jQuery中获取元素宽度(含padding)的方法是innerWidth。()
1、jQuery中获取元素宽度(含padding)的方法是innerWidth。
2、例如: this is div tag 如要获取id为oDiv的div标签的宽度 可以使用query如下写法 (#oDiv).width();jquery讲义:width() 方法返回或设置匹配元素的宽度。
3、width() 是元素内部实际内容的宽度(不包含内边距和边框的宽度);innerWidth() 则是上面的width()再加上内边距;outerWidth() 则是上面的innerWidth()再加上边框的宽度。
4、第二种情况就是宽和高是写在行内中,比如style=width:120px;,这中情况通过上述2个方法都能拿到宽度。
html各种页面宽度outerWidth、innerWidth、clientWidth
1、window.outerWidth : 浏览器宽度。window.innerHeight : 浏览器内页面可用高度;此高度包含了水平滚动条的高度(若存在)。可表示为浏览器当前高度去除浏览器边框、工具条后的高度。
2、通过 document.documentElement.clientWidth 和 document.documentElement.clientHeight //document.documentElement实际上是html元素 获取 我们平时设置的html/body width:100%,实际上就是设置html,body等于视口的宽度。
3、clientWidth:对象内容的可视区的宽度,不包滚动条等边线,会随对象显示大小的变化而改变。offsetWidth:对象整体的实际宽度,包滚动条等边线,会随对象显示大小的变化而改变。
4、直接设置选择标记的宽度。首先,在文件中创建一个新的HTML文件和两个select下拉列表 然后在顶部的head标记中设置样式表。首先,设置第一个选择标记的宽度。